Overview
- Noble announced the Osprey true wireless earbuds and set pre-orders to begin on June 4, 2026 with shipping expected by the end of June.
- The earbuds use a hybrid dual-driver design that pairs a 10mm dynamic driver with a custom balanced armature to deliver controlled bass, natural mids, and extended highs.
- Noble built the Osprey around an Airoha 1571 chipset that supports Bluetooth 5.4, LDAC high-resolution audio, Multipoint connectivity, and TrueWireless Mirroring for easy switching between devices.
- Key user features include active noise cancellation, a Hearing Through mode, dual microphones with cVc noise reduction for clearer calls, and app-based EQ plus OTA firmware updates.
- Priced at $199 / £199 / €225 and housed in a compact aluminium USB-C charging case, the Osprey is positioned as Noble’s most accessible model and will be available to try at HIGH END Vienna 2026.
